Random Useful Information
- Always wear clothes that you can get wet in, and shoes that will stay on your feet.
- You are welcome to bring lunch or snacks on the river, but no glass containers.
- No alcohol is allowed on either river.
- The Big South Fork River is located about an hour from Sheltowee Trace Adventure Resort.
- Trips on the Big South Fork meet at the take-out point. We take you to the put-in point and you canoe/kayak back to your vehicle.
- All boats must be in by 6pm
- Backcountry permits are required for overnight trips on the Big South Fork
- Trips on the Cumberland River meet at Sheltowee Trace Adventure Resort. You follow the driver to the take-out point and canoe/kayak back to your vehicle.
- Parking permits (no-charge) are required when leaving a vehicle overnight at Cumberland Falls State Park
